iNET 900 SCADA Radio

The MDS iNET Series is an industrial wireless solution that provides long distance, unlicensed communications allowing users to interface with Ethernet and serial controllers. Comprised of the iNET 900 and iNET-II, the iNET Series offers the best balance of speed and range to enable a wide variety of applications requiring higher data capabilities than typical communication systems can provide. The iNET Series combines the higher speed of Digital Transmission Systems (DTS) with the robustness of Frequency Hopping Spread Spectrum (FHSS) technology.

Key Benefits
  • Unlicensed IP/Ethernet and serial data communication
  • High speed, long range point-to-multipoint
  • Prevents unauthorized network access and secures wireless data
  • Reduce configuration and integration costs with a single-box solution
  • Advanced unlicensed interference mitigation algorithms
  • Operation in extreme temperature ranges and hazardous locations
